שמות, פרק ל״ה, פסוק ל״א

פרשת ויקהל

Exodus 35:31Sefaria

וַיְמַלֵּ֥א אֹת֖וֹ ר֣וּחַ אֱלֹהִ֑ים בְּחׇכְמָ֛ה בִּתְבוּנָ֥ה וּבְדַ֖עַת וּבְכׇל־מְלָאכָֽה׃

Constructing a dwelling place for God required a unique blend of spiritual elevation and broad practical skill. However, the granting of this divine spirit did not happen in a vacuum. God rests His spirit and imparts additional wisdom specifically to those who already possess a baseline of understanding [רא״ש]. Beyond the general traits of wisdom, understanding, and knowledge, God ensured that the artisan received a special, added measure of expertise spanning every type of physical craftsmanship [אבן עזרא, ביאור שטיינזלץ].

This divine inspiration was not restricted to a single individual. God granted wisdom and understanding to anyone who genuinely desired to participate in the construction. He helped them bring their good intentions to life, even if they had absolutely no prior experience in these crafts. The influence of God's spirit during the building of the Tabernacle was so expansive that even the wild animals and livestock present in the area received a measure of understanding from Him [צאינה וראינה].

The specific threefold combination of wisdom, understanding, and knowledge reflects a deep cosmic and historical pattern. These are the exact same qualities through which God established the world itself. Furthermore, these traits serve as the constant foundation for all of God's dwelling places throughout history. They were present when King Solomon built the First Temple, and they will be the very foundation upon which the future Temple is established [דעת זקנים].
